QBE Strengthens Cyber Insurance Offerings

Addressing Escalating Cyber Threats with Enhanced Support for Brokers and Clients

In response to the growing prevalence of cyber threats and increasingly stringent regulations, QBE Insurance has announced a strategic initiative to bolster its cyber insurance capabilities.
This move aims to provide brokers and their clients with more robust support in navigating the complex landscape of cyber risks.

Andrew Horton, Group CEO of QBE, emphasised the critical nature of cyber risk as a defining challenge for contemporary businesses. He highlighted the accelerating pace of change in the cyber threat environment and underscored QBE's commitment to investing in global capabilities and innovative solutions through its corporate venture capital arm, QBE Ventures. This investment is designed to ensure that QBE's cyber insurance offerings evolve in tandem with market needs.

During a recent cyber insights event in Sydney, attended by 50 brokers, QBE leaders and industry experts discussed various aspects of the cyber insurance market, including current perspectives, risk management guidance, and future threat projections. This collaborative approach reflects QBE's dedication to equipping brokers with the knowledge and tools necessary to effectively support their clients.

In July of the previous year, QBE launched its global cyber insurance policy, QCyberProtect, marking a significant step in its cyber insurance strategy. Additionally, in December, QBE Ventures expressed interest in supporting more cyber-focused startups, further demonstrating the company's proactive stance in addressing cyber risks.

Australian Insurers Report $1.11 Billion Profit in Q1 2025
Australian Insurers Report $1.11 Billion Profit in Q1 2025
29 Dec 2025: Paige Estritori
The Australian insurance industry has reported a net profit after tax of $1.11 billion for the first quarter of 2025, according to the latest data from the Australian Prudential Regulation Authority (APRA). This figure includes contributions of $990 million from insurers and $123 million from reinsurers.
